In depth

Verdict

A really competitive renewal of a race drenched in tradition and a chance for THREAT to gain a Group success after runner-up efforts in both the Coventry at Royal Ascot and the Richmond at Goodwood. Beaten less than a length on each occasion, he is faced by a host of talented sorts but still sets the standard. Kevin Ryan has a good record in this contest and fields a trio of contenders of which course and distance winner, Abstemious, makes greatest appeal with Jamie Spencer booked. Malotru gives the impression he has more to offer and the likes of Spartan Fighter, Dubai Station and Misty Grey are others with a decent chance in a fine race.
